Look-alike desk: veto vs voto
A purely visual mix-up. veto ([ˈbet̪o]) and voto ([ˈbot̪o]) are said differently, so reading them aloud is the quickest way to catch the wrong one. On the page they stay close: they differ by a single letter - e in “veto” becomes o in “voto”.
